Beatrice Sprague- Argentine High School Senior
1930 Senior Yearbook photo of Beatrice Sprague from Argentine High School. Next to her photo it listed her extracurricular including: "Glee Club, 4; Student Council, 3, 4; Annual Staff, 4; Operetta, 4; Cantata, 4; Junior Play, 3; Debate Squad, 3, 4; Girl Reserves, 2, 4; Oratorical Contest, 2, 3, 4; Latin Club, 1, Vice-Pres-ident, 2; Honor Society, 1; National Honor Society. "
Date & Place: at Argentine Middle School 2123 Ruby Avenue, in Kansas City, Wyandotte County, Kansas 66106, United States

Laura Beatrice Sprague Keele
Laura Beatrice Sprague was born on May 23, 1914 in Gravette, Benton, Arkansas to parents Henry Monroe Sprague (1870-1938) and Dora Mae Sprague (1879-1956). She had an older brother George L Sprague and her family moved to Kansas City, Wyandotte, Kansas, USA in the 1920s. She married Howard Durell Keele (1910–1998) in 1933 and they had a daughter together Laura Louise "Lolly" Keele (1934-2000). They later separated and she re married on February 6, 1970 to Allen Roscar Gray (1918–) in Rich Hill, Bates, Missouri, USA. Laura Beatrice Gray passed away on June 9, 1981 in Russellville, Cole, Missouri.
